Formula & Methodology

The cutoff frequency (fc) of a low pass filter is given by fc = 1 / (2 * π * R * C). The calculator uses this formula…

What is a low pass filter?

A low pass filter allows signals below a certain frequency to pass while attenuating signals above that frequency.
